Job Description

This role focuses on ensuring the safety and reliability of energy systems by identifying design risks and defining/developing design validation specifications for thermal abuse scenarios. The position involves close collaboration with cross-functional teams to innovate and implement safety measures for battery and energy storage systems, contributing to the advancement of cutting-edge energy solutions.

Responsibilities

  • Maintain and develop thermal abuse design validation specifications
  • Develop new test protocols to explore design risks in emerging designs and applications
  • Apply thermal abuse expertise to identify early-phase design risks
  • Develop novel mitigation methods to enhance safety in energy systems
  • Collaborate with engineering teams to integrate safety specifications into product designs
  • Analyze test results to refine validation processes and improve system reliability
  • Document and communicate findings to support design and safety reviews
